Stronghold Crusader: Definitive Edition Overview
Stronghold Crusader: Definitive Edition is the expanded edition of the original 2002 Stronghold Crusader game, adding a plethora of new content such as 8 new playable units, 4 new AI lords, and new campaigns. Engage in historical skirmishes, travelling back in the era of the legendary crusades. In the Definitive Edition, the experience is enhanced with new gameplay and upgraded visuals.
Embark on a journey with either Richard the Lionheart, King of England, or Sultan Saladin, head of the Ayyubid Dynasty and ruler of the Islamic domain. Lead a resolute band of Crusaders, fire-forged by warfare throughout the years, or fight for the freedom of the dynasty as Saladin’s army. Campaigns span different periods of the Crusades, from the First to the Third Crusades, and various conflicts.
Stronghold Crusader: Definitive Edition Gameplay

As a real-time-strategy (RTS) city builder, players assume the role of either Richard the Lionheart, or Sultan Saladin, to establish a robust military and claim over the distant Arabian lands. Situated in the desert sands of the Middle East, players will take on the forces of nature along with enemy lines, making sure that their desert fortresses are well-equipped.
Outside of campaigns, players can also dive into the all-improved skirmish mode with larger maps, options for customization, and quality of life (QoL) improvements.
